left4me: ship a /usr/local/sbin/left4me wrapper for the flask CLI
One-liner instead of "ssh + heredoc + sudo + sh -c + double quotes":
  sudo left4me create-user alice --admin
  sudo left4me seed-script-overlays /opt/left4me/src/examples/script-overlays
  sudo left4me routes

The wrapper sources host.env + web.env, drops to the left4me user,
sets JOB_WORKER_ENABLED=false (admin-side ops shouldn't race the
worker) and PYTHONPATH=/opt/left4me/src, then exec's the flask CLI
with whatever args followed `left4me`. No env-var enumeration: the
sh -c trailing 'sh "$@"' forwards positional args without quoting
hell. README updated to drop the verbose recipe.
